What is a War Diary? The headquarters of each unit and formation of the British Army in the field was ordered to maintain a record of its location, movements and activities. For the most part, these details were recorded on a standard army form headed 'War diary or intelligence summary'. What details are given? Details given vary greatly, depending on the nature of the unit, what it was doing and, to some extent, the style of the man writing it. The entries vary from very simple and repetitive statements like 'Training' up to many pages of description when a unit was in battle. Production of the diary was the responsibility of the Adjutant of the headquarters concerned. Is there any other information or documents with the diaries? Some diaries have other documentation attached, such as maps, operational orders and after-action reports.

Full colour facsimile reprint of the original First World War, War Office war diary of the 1/8th Battalion, Durham Light Infantry, 151 Infantry Brigade, 50th Division, covering April 1915 to January 1917 across 840 pages. It names 45 places across 90 dated entries.Alongside the daily entries the volume carries two lists of honours and awards, five casualty and personnel returns, 83 reports, narratives and plans, 37 Operation Orders, four appendices, eight maps and one diagram. Among the papers are: Honours and awards; Honours awards; Nominal roll of All officers Embarking At Folkestone; Return of casualties; Casualties during operations 15th-30th Sept; Confidential Intelligence Summaries; 50th Division Confidential Intelligence Summary (Continuation of "Part II" Series); Report on Action by 8th Durh. L.I 3/4 Mile E. of St Julien; Special orders of the Day; Special order of the Day; Operation orders; Operation orders Lt. 8th Batt. Durh. L.I.The diary opens at Bolougne on 20 April 1915. 1915 is spent at Armentieres, Houplines, La Creche, Potijze and Maple Copse. 1916 is the most travelled year, 49 places against 24 in the next busiest, and is spent at Near Bailleul, The Somme, Baizieux, Henencourt Wood and Ridgewood. 1917 at Bazentin Le Petit. It closes at Bazentin Le Petit on 31 January 1917. Armentieres is where it spent longest, 83 days across five separate stays, including a single unbroken stay of 31 and it came back to Dickebusch six separate times.Trench and battlefield features named in the diary include Henencourt Wood, Sanctuary Wood, Maple Copse, Becourt Wood, Lindenhoek Trenches, Railway Dugouts, Armagh Wood and 6th Avenue East.In 1915 it is also recorded at St Marie Cappel, Marie Cappel, Vlamertinge, Veloren Hoek, Brielen, St Jan-Ter-Biezen, A Camp, C Camp, C. Huts and Hooge. In 1916 it is also recorded at Dickebusch, Sanctuary Wood, Maple Copse, Railway Dugouts, Hill 60, Bedford House, Armagh Wood, Poperinghe, The Bluff and Canada Huts.
